Compostable Coffee Capsules

Challenge:
The global coffee industry has seen a significant rise in popularity, particularly for single-serve coffee capsules, whose global market is growing and currently estimated at 82 billion units.
While these capsules offer convenience, they also pose environmental challenges at the end of their lifecycle. Coffee capsules are a unique type of packaging designed to be used and disposed along with their contents. However, whether they are recycled or incinerated, the organic content – which accounts for approximately 80% of the total weight – is lost.
Solution:
Certified compostable capsules disintegrate and biodegrade along with the coffee ground without compromising the compost quality or leaving behind persistent microplastics, unlike conventional plastic capsules which are often found contaminating the organic waste stream. Furthermore, the adoption of compostable capsules reduces the contamination of other recycling streams with organic material and diverts waste from incineration and landfills.
Taghleef Industries, through its reDESIGN™ service, is at the forefront of this transition, actively collaborating with industry partners to develop industrially compostable coffee capsule solutions incorporating NATIVIA® films, with several such solutions already available to consumers.
NATIVIA® BOPLA films are effectively utilized as a sealant layer in the lidding of industrially compostable coffee capsules, in lamination with other compostable substrates. They exhibit excellent compatibility with commercially available PLA-based capsule bodies, providing a strong seal that contributes to preserving the coffee’s freshness.
Looking ahead, ongoing developments within the NATIVIA® portfolio are perfectly aligned with evolving market demands, targeting the creation of high-barrier and home compostable solutions for coffee capsules.
